What is true about Germany's use of U-boats is that these boats sank ships that carried civilians during World War 1, such as the RMS Lusitania ship.

A German U-boat sank the RMS Lusitania transatlantic ship that transported civilians on May 7, 1915. Great Britain had declared the North Sea as a war zone in 1914 and prohibited all imports coming from Germany. Although the Germany embassy in the US published in the newspaper warnings to avoid navigation in the conflictive zone, the Lusitania navigated those waters and the tragedy occurred. This was one of the reasons that pushed President Woodrow Wilson into Worl War 1.
